NUEVA ECIJA has ascended to the pinnacle, as D'Generals won the 2026 Smart-NBTC North Luzon Regional Championship.
Rebounding demon Jhonlord Cruz put his team on his shoulders, as the Novo Ecijanos pulled off a thrilling 91-89 finale against Marlins of Bulacan at University of Baguio Cardinals Gym on Tuesday.
Cruz uncorked 19 points and grabbed 23 rebounds in the clincher, including the game-sealing block on Jerald Raymundo as time expired to hold off a furious fourth quarter rally from the Bulakenyos.
More importantly, it capped off Cruz' memorable performance, one that saw him set a new NBTC record for most rebounds per game after hauling down 27 boards in the semifinals against Yes Mariveles, en route to being named as the adidas Most Outstanding Player.
Fellow Mythical Team member Jairus Armendez also did damage with 19 points built on three triples, on top of four boards, four assists, and two steals, while Nueva Ecija also drew big games from Alfie Jay Pacaldo, who nabbed a double-double of 20 points and 11 rebounds, and Peter Hendrick Junior, who had 19 points and four boards.
The Marlins, however, refused to go down without a fight, crawling back from a 14-point deficit, 72-58, early in the fourth and leaned on Christian James Manlapaz (19 points and eight rebounds) and Justine Dave Batibot (21 points).
Manlapaz was also part of the Mythical Five together with Mark Khelvin Macalinao of Yes Mariveles (Bataan) and Mark Daniel Dela Cruz of CCDC Admirals (Benguet).
Nonetheless, the two finalists are already bound for the National Finals from March 22 to 29 where they will play with the best teams in the Philippine national 19-under tournament which is supported by adidas, Foot Locker, Molten, Buffalo's Wings N Things, The Lighthouse Group, Pocari Sweat, Omni, Swish, and the Samahang Basketbol ng Pilipinas (SBP).
Yes Mariveles and CCDC Admirals have also punched their tickets to the Nationals through the regional wildcard, making the most of their second chances to complete the North Luzon cast.
The Bataan champs routed PPG Tarlac, 102-78, behind Macalinao's 13 points, as six other players scored in double-figures.
CCDC also eked out a 74-72 decision over Quezon Nueva Ecija, with Dela Cruz firing 16 points and seven rebounds and Joel Christ Ancheta scoring 14.
Attention now shifts to the Visayas Regional Championship on Feb. 11 to 14, with Tacloban City Convention Center serving as main host.
